You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
 
 
 
 
 
 
Nolan Rigo 2577c5cfa9 Frontend: fix broken links (#342) 6 years ago
.github Added .github/ISSUE_TEMPLATE.md (optional) 7 years ago
backend [mono repo] remove git cached files 6 years ago
cli [mono repo] remove git cached files 6 years ago
cordova [mono repo] remove git cached files 6 years ago
core [mono repo] remove git cached files 6 years ago
cozy [mono repo] remove git cached files 6 years ago
desktop [mono repo] remove git cached files 6 years ago
frontend Frontend: fix broken links (#342) 6 years ago
logo Adding the lastest version of lesspass-pure 6 years ago
move [mono repo] remove git cached files 6 years ago
nginx [mono repo] remove git cached files 6 years ago
openssl [mono repo] remove git cached files 6 years ago
pure [mono repo] remove git cached files 6 years ago
render-password [mono repo] remove git cached files 6 years ago
scripts [mono repo] remove git cached files 6 years ago
snap [mono repo] remove git cached files 6 years ago
webextension [mono repo] remove git cached files 6 years ago
.gitmodules Delete mobile and entropy submodules 6 years ago
CONTRIBUTING.md edit email 7 years ago
LICENSE change license from MIT to GNU GPLv3 8 years ago
README.md Add Stephane vidéo 6 years ago
docker-compose.prod.yml fix the version of nginx container until update script is up 7 years ago
docker-compose.yml Use links instead of depends_on in Docker compose files (#97) 8 years ago
lesspass.sh typo in lesspass script 7 years ago

README.md

LessPass

LessPass open source password manager (https://lesspass.com)

Backers on Open Collective Sponsors on Open Collective

How does it work?

Videos

Self Host your LessPass Database

requirements

  • docker
  • docker-compose

install

simply run

bash <(curl -s https://raw.githubusercontent.com/lesspass/lesspass/master/lesspass.sh) [DOMAIN] [EMAIL]

[DOMAIN] and [EMAIL] are used to generate a LetsEncrypt certificate and configure LessPass.

create super user

Go into the backend container and create a super user

docker exec -it lesspass_backend_1 sh
python manage.py createsuperuser

Now you can access and manage users and password profiles on https://[DOMAIN]/admin

configure email

You can edit .env file to use your own email server (in order to reset the password for example)

DEFAULT_FROM_EMAIL="LessPass" <admin@example.org>
EMAIL_HOST=...
EMAIL_HOST_USER=...
EMAIL_HOST_PASSWORD=...
EMAIL_PORT=...
EMAIL_USE_TLS=1

License

This project is licensed under the terms of the GNU GPLv3.

Contributors ❤️

This project exists thanks to all the people who contribute. [Contribute].